Three Moves You Never Make at a Top-Tier UK Casino

Based on my experience at the tables and behind the scenes, here are three things that will sink your session. Avoid these like a bad beat.

  • Never use a shared or exchange wallet for deposits. This is the biggest rookie error. You want wallet anonymity. If you deposit from a wallet that has a history of mixing funds or is linked to other gambling sites, the casino’s compliance team might freeze your withdrawal. Always use a clean, personal wallet. A dedicated crypto address for gambling is your best friend.
  • Never ignore the wagering clock on a crypto bonus. I see this all the time. A player grabs a 100% bonus with 35x wagering. They think they have a week. Then they check the T&Cs. It’s 35x within 72 hours. That is brutal. On a trusted site, the clock is clear. But you have to read it. I’ve seen players lose £500 in value because they missed a 48-hour deadline. Always check the ‘Max cashout’ too. Some offers cap it at £150, which is a joke.
  • Never play live dealer games on a weak Wi-Fi connection. This sounds obvious, but it kills the stream quality. I’ve watched players get disconnected mid-hand. The dealer waits. The bet is lost. If you are playing blackjack or roulette with a real dealer, you need a stable connection. A buffering stream is not the dealer’s fault. It’s yours. If the stream quality drops below 1080p, walk away.

How to Verify a Trusted UK Gambling Site in 2026

Here is a quick checklist. I use this every time I sign up for a new site. Do not skip these steps.

  1. Check the license footer. Scroll to the bottom. Look for the UKGC logo. Click it. It should take you to the official UKGC register. If it’s a dead link, run.
  2. Test the live chat. Ask a dumb question like “What is the max withdrawal limit for Bitcoin?” If the agent takes longer than 2 minutes to respond or gives a vague answer, that is a red flag. Professional dealers and support teams know their limits.
  3. Check the withdrawal policy for crypto. Look for the words “instant” or “manual review”. If they say “manual review”, expect a 24-hour hold. I prefer sites that process crypto withdrawals automatically, even if it’s a small fee.
  4. Look for GamStop integration. A truly responsible UK site will be on GamStop. If you need to self-exclude, it must work. If they aren’t on GamStop, they are operating in a grey area. Be careful.

How do I know if a casino is truly ‘trusted’?

Look for a valid UKGC license number. Then check the ‘Responsible Gambling’ page. A trusted site will have links to GamCare, GamStop, and BeGambleAware. If they only have a generic “18+” notice, that is a bad sign. Real trusted sites also publish their payout percentages (RTP) for games.

What happens if I win a big jackpot on a crypto deposit?

You will need to complete KYC (Know Your Customer) before you can withdraw. Even on crypto sites. The casino will ask for ID, proof of address, and sometimes a source of funds. This is standard. Do not try to hide your winnings. Just be honest. The process usually takes 24-48 hours for a manual review.
